Understanding Due Dates

Due dates refer to the specific time frames within which certain tasks or events must be completed or are expected to occur. In the context of pregnancy, a due date is typically calculated based on the first day of the last menstrual period, often giving parents a window of time that can influence their preparations and planning. In project management, due dates are established based on project timelines, resource availability, and task dependencies, making it essential for team members to understand them to avoid delays. Miscalculating these dates can lead to significant consequences, such as last-minute scrambles to finish a project or being unprepared for a newborn's arrival. Understanding how due dates are determined in various scenarios is the first step toward accurate planning.

Tips for Accurate Due Date Calculations

To ensure accurate due date calculations, it's essential to follow best practices and remain vigilant about common errors. Begin by double-checking the information you input into any calculator or app, as minor mistakes can lead to significant discrepancies. Familiarize yourself with the variables that may affect your due date, such as variations in menstrual cycle lengths for pregnancy calculations or potential delays in project timelines. Additionally, regularly updating your tools and staying informed about any changes in guidelines or recommendations can help maintain accuracy in your calculations.
